亭
tíng
What does 亭 mean?
Traveler reading for VibeHanzi · seen at 2 published landmarks
What it means
pavilion
Spot it here
At 湖心亭 (Huxinting) mid-pond, and other open pause-roofs among Yu Garden’s rockeries — named stops between zigzag turns.
Remember this
Look for an open roof on three sides with 亭 in the plaque. Huxinting is the famous mid-water version — a stand-under stop, not a closed hall.
